Why Rolex is Expensive:

Rolex's high price tag is a multifaceted phenomenon, a result of a carefully cultivated brand image, meticulous manufacturing processes, and a robust secondary market. Several factors contribute to its premium cost:

* Brand Recognition and Prestige: Rolex has spent decades cultivating a powerful brand identity. Its association with success, status, and enduring quality has cemented its place as a globally recognized symbol of luxury. This brand equity translates directly into a higher price point. The perceived exclusivity and desirability significantly inflate the perceived value.

* Manufacturing and Materials: Rolex utilizes high-quality materials, including 904L stainless steel (more corrosion-resistant than the 316L steel used by many competitors), 18-karat gold, and ethically sourced gems. The manufacturing process is meticulous, involving rigorous quality control at every stage. This commitment to precision and craftsmanship adds to the cost. Each watch undergoes extensive testing to ensure its reliability and accuracy.

* Vertical Integration: Rolex maintains a significant degree of vertical integration, meaning it controls much of its own production process, from the creation of its movements to the final assembly. This allows for better quality control and potentially lower costs in the long run, but it also requires substantial investment in infrastructure and expertise.

* Research and Development: Rolex continuously invests in research and development, constantly pushing the boundaries of horological innovation. Its patented technologies, such as the Parachrom hairspring and the Chronergy escapement, contribute to the exceptional performance and durability of its watches. This ongoing investment is reflected in the final price.

* Supply and Demand: The demand for Rolex watches consistently outstrips supply. This artificial scarcity contributes to their high price, as collectors and enthusiasts are willing to pay a premium to acquire these coveted timepieces. Long waiting lists for popular models further solidify this dynamic.

Are Rolex Watches Overpriced?

The question of whether Rolex watches are overpriced is subjective and depends on individual perspectives and priorities. While the cost is undeniably high, the argument for their value often rests on several points:

* Resale Value: Rolex watches generally hold their value well, and in some cases, appreciate in value over time, especially vintage or limited-edition models. This makes them a relatively safe investment compared to other luxury goods.

* Durability and Reliability: Rolex watches are renowned for their robustness and reliability. They are built to last a lifetime and often passed down through generations. This longevity justifies the initial investment for many buyers.

* Craftsmanship and Quality: The meticulous craftsmanship and high-quality materials used in Rolex watches are undeniable. The attention to detail and precision engineering reflect the price tag.

* Status Symbol: For many, the prestige and status associated with owning a Rolex are intrinsic parts of its value proposition. The social capital associated with the brand contributes significantly to its appeal.
